Storing Peeled Potatoes in Water:
One of the easiest ways to preserve peeled potatoes is by storing them in water. This method can keep the potatoes fresh for up to 24 hours. To store peeled potatoes in water, follow these steps:
- Peel the potatoes and cut them into desired size.
- Put the potatoes into a bowl of cold water immediately after peeling.
- Make sure the potatoes are completely submerged in water.
- Cover the bowl with a lid or plastic wrap.
- Store the bowl in the fridge.

Freezing Peeled Potatoes:
Freezing peeled potatoes is another option to preserve them for longer. This method can keep the potatoes fresh for up to six months. To freeze peeled potatoes, follow these steps:
- Peel the potatoes and cut them into desired size.
- Blanch the potatoes in boiling water for two minutes.
- Drain the potatoes and cool them down quickly.
- Put the potatoes into a freezer bag or airtight container.
- Label the bag or container with the date and the contents.
- Store the bag or container in the freezer.
